KB AI Review Lite
Goal
Perform a lightweight AI validation pass on one or more KB files and store the result as metadata only.
This sample intentionally focuses on one pattern: create required list columns when absent, then populate them.

Guardrails
- Do NOT modify the original KB document content.
- Do NOT create or upload draft Word files.
- Do NOT publish content.
- Only update the fields defined in this skill.
- Return results in Markdown.

Recertification Cadence
Set NextReviewDate using category-based intervals:
Security->CompletedOn + 30 daysInfrastructure->CompletedOn + 60 daysGeneral->CompletedOn + 90 daysApplications->CompletedOn + 90 daysOther->CompletedOn + 90 days
If the user supplies an override cadence, apply it instead.
Accuracy Baseline
Assess KB content using category-specific sources:
- Security: Validate against Microsoft MSRC, vendor CVE databases, and internal security policies.
- Infrastructure: Validate against vendor documentation (AWS, Azure, Cisco, etc.), public runbooks, and internal standards.
- Applications: Validate against application vendor docs, public APIs, and internal implementation standards.
- General: Validate for internal consistency and alignment with internal policy.
- Other: Validate for internal consistency only.
When using web sources, prioritize official vendor documentation first. Include source URLs for any critical correction.
Output Quality Gates
The review is considered weak and must be regenerated if any of the following occur:
- Findings are generic (for example: "validate details" or "recheck meanings") without concrete wrong and correct values.
Update Required: Yesis set but no specific section identifiers are listed.- Fewer than 5 concrete findings are reported when a document has obvious factual issues.
- Critical operational or safety issues are found but not labeled as
Highseverity. - No evidence source is provided for material factual corrections.
Update Required: Nois returned withFindings: 0for a parameter-heavy document (URLs, versions, timeouts, ports, phone numbers, thresholds, procedures) without explicit claim-by-claim verification evidence.- Summary says
Update Required: Nobut payload still contains open questions that imply unresolved factual uncertainty.
Minimum detail requirements when updates are needed:
- Summary must include at least 5 concrete findings; target 8+ for heavily incorrect documents.
- Each finding must include: section identifier, incorrect claim, corrected value, and severity (
High,Medium,Low).
Minimum detail requirements when no updates are claimed:
- If
Update Required: No, includeVerified Claims: <count>in summary. Verified Claimsmust be at least 8 for operational KBs.- Payload must include a
## Verification Evidencesection with at least 8 verified claim rows and sources. - If these conditions are not met, treat the review as failed quality gate.

Process
Step 1 - Resolve Target and Schema
- Determine target library and files (selected items, named files, or full library).
- Run
get_list_schemato inspect column definitions. - If an item is already
Published, skip it unless re-review is explicitly requested.
Step 2 - Provision Missing Columns
- For each required column, check by internal name first.
- Create only missing columns using standard column creation. Do not create duplicates.
- Always create columns as standard columns, not autofill or content extraction columns. Column values are written explicitly by this skill. Never prompt the user to choose between column modes.

Step 2.1 - Apply Column Formatting
After provisioning columns, apply column formatting to these fields:
AIReviewState: colored pill (green=Review Complete, blue=Published, orange=Not Run)ReviewScore: percentage bar with color thresholds (green ≥80, orange ≥50, red <50)KB Category: colored pill (green=Security, blue=Infrastructure, orange=General, purple=Applications, gray=Other)
Apply formatting via the Format column option. This is a display-only change and does not affect stored values.
Step 3 - Read Content (Read-Only)
- Read each file with
cat_file. - If a file cannot be read, mark as failed and continue processing the rest.
- Extract concrete assertions to verify (versions, URLs, ports, protocols, thresholds, timing values, part numbers, and procedural safety steps).
- Validate those assertions against the Accuracy Baseline for that KB category.

Constraints
- Never edit the body content of source KB files.
- Never publish content.
- Always run schema check before updates.
- Never create duplicate columns with alternate naming.
- Continue processing remaining files if one file fails.
- If a file is already
Published, skip it unless user explicitly asks to re-review published content. - Always map each reviewed file to exactly one KB category.
